Mammals are a group of warm-blooded animals that have hair or fur, and whose females produce milk to feed their young. One of the primary characteristics that distinguish mammals from other vertebrates is the presence of mammary glands, which are specialized organs used for the production of milk. However, when it comes to the method of reproduction, mammals can be broadly categorized into two main groups based on how they give birth to their offspring: viviparous mammals, which give birth to live young, and oviparous mammals, which lay eggs.

The latter category brings us to the crux of our inquiry. While the majority of mammals are viviparous, there exists a small but intriguing group of mammals that diverge from this norm by laying eggs instead of giving birth to live young. These mammals are known as monotremes, a group that includes the most iconic and perhaps the only well-known examples of egg-laying mammals: the platypus and the echidna.

The Platypus: A Marvel of Nature

The platypus (Ornithorhynchus anatinus) is one of the most peculiar creatures in the animal kingdom. Native to eastern Australia and Tasmania, this mammal is renowned for its duck-billed snout, webbed feet, and the ability to lay eggs. One of the most fascinating aspects of the platypus is its venomous spur, found on the male’s hind leg, which is used for defense. The platypus is also one of the few venomous mammals, making it a subject of great interest among scientists and the general public alike.

The reproductive cycle of the platypus is quite unique. After mating, the female platypus lays a clutch of leathery eggs in a burrow or nesting chamber. The number of eggs can vary, but typically, a female platypus lays between one and three eggs at a time. The incubation period is approximately two weeks, during which time the female keeps the eggs warm and safe. Once the eggs hatch, the young platypuses are hairless, blind, and completely dependent on their mother’s milk for survival.

The Echidna: Another Egg-Laying Marvel

The echidna, which includes four species (the short-beaked echidna and three species of long-beaked echidna), is another monotreme that lays eggs. Echidnas are found in Australia and New Guinea and are recognized by their spiny, ant-eating demeanor. Like the platypus, echidnas have a unique method of reproduction. Female echidnas lay a single, leathery egg into a burrow or a nesting chamber, which they then incubate until it hatches.

The young echidna, similar to the platypus, is born blind and hairless but soon develops its characteristic spines. The female echidna does not have nipples; instead, she produces milk that pools on her belly, allowing the young to lap it up. This unique method of nursing is a testament to the evolutionary adaptations of monotremes.

What is unique about the platypus's venom?

+

The platypus's venom is delivered through a spur on the male's hind leg and is used primarily for defense. The venom contains over 80 different peptides and is capable of causing significant pain to humans, although it is not lethal.
